Re: Lumin L2 Music Library and Network Switch
Can one use larger drives than 4 TB? Is that a system limitation or is 4 TB just the largest being offered?
What is the value of having an internal switch? The L2 can be purchased without drives, with a 4TB drive, or with an 8TB drive. I'm not sure of the maximum size, but for 8TB it uses NTFS which has varying maximum capacities depending on what configurations are supported. My first guess would be that at least 16TB is supported. A 16TB SSD is a bit expensive right now.
If you have other products in your audio system that can use a network connection, then the L2 offers the option of providing a low-noise network jack for that other component. For example a Lumin streamer. And the L2 needs a network connection to begin with, in order to act as a music server. So you're basically saying one connection to your wider network, plus a dedicated connection to your streamer. (Assuming the L2 and streamer would be on a switch and not a hub to begin with, they should already only receiving packets addressed to them or sent as broadcast or multicast. So it's not so much the network traffic as much as it is the isolation and possible side-channel noise filtering.)Neko Audio

Re: Lumin L2 Music Library and Network Switch
Lumin is no longer the company they used yo be. I would suggest you to look elsewhere.
See my terrible experience below with my Lumin L2 due yo Lumin failing to provide any installation information and screws/adaptors.
I owned a P1 and bought a L2 recently. It is a pain to setup the L2. First, as said, there is no online manual and the printed manuals contain nothing about installing and setting up the SSDs. The L2 comes with no screws and adaptors, which are special types, for mounting the SSDs. As soon as I got the screws and mounting adaptors, I put in 2 4TB SSDs and turned on the L2 and the screen showed HDD error. No information could be found to resolve this issue. I fdisk the SSDs and reinstalled the SSDs. I got the HDD Error again. I removed the SSDs again and formatted them before reinstalling them. I got the HDD error again. I consider myself very lucky as I tried holding the sleep button and a harddisk formatting screen showed up. The screen turned off and nothing happened. I turned off the switch and turned on the L2 again. I saw the deadly HDD Error screen again. I tried to hold the Sleep button again and it seemed to have the SSDs formatted this time. The L2 started finally started normally but it was not the end of the nighmare. When I copied files to the L2 over the network, I got the "Error 0x8007003B".
Lumin alleged that the L2 is zero configuration which is untrue and misleading.
